Grooved couplings are categorized into two primary types: Rigid Couplings and Flexible Couplings.

 

Rigid Couplings are designed for piping systems requiring structural rigidity. Featuring built-in grip teeth, these couplings create a secure, non-yielding connection comparable to traditional flanged, welded, or threaded joints.

Available Sizes 1–12 inch (DN25–DN300)
Working Pressure 300 PSI | FM Approved / UL Certified
Coating Options Red Painted / Galvanized / Epoxy Blue / Grey
Gasket Materials EPDM / NITRILE / SILICON


Product Features

Our tongue-and-groove rigid couplings are engineered for applications requiring structural rigidity. While grooved coupling systems are widely recognized for streamlined installation, our design stands apart:

 

Integral Tooth Mechanism: Built-in teeth securely grip pipe ends, eliminating unwanted flexing and ensuring reliable load transfer.

Installation Efficiency: The grooved connection system reduces installation time compared to traditional methods, ideal for tight schedules.

Certification Compliance: Specific product listings and technical data are available on FM (Factory Mutual) and UL (Underwriters Laboratories) official websites for compliance verification.


Key benefits include:

 

Zero Angular Deflection: Eliminates rotational or lateral movement post-installation, ensuring precise alignment in long pipeline runs.

Axial Stability: Prevents unwanted axial displacement, ideal for high-pressure applications or systems subject to mechanical stress.

Installation Simplicity: Streamlines setup in rigid pipe networks, reducing labor time while maintaining leak-proof integrity.


Ideal for industrial, commercial, and municipal applications where rigidity and reliability are critical, these couplings combine the ease of grooved connections with the strength of permanent joints.
